A Finance Assistant role has arisen with successful and progressive business in Diss.A hugely varied role, working with a talented team, this role will involve the following tasks:
  • Reconciliation of balance sheets and bank reconciliations
  • Manage in-boxes, calls and queries as required
  • Manage and maintain relationships with key stakeholders across the business
  • Support and assist the Management Accounts team 
  • Assist in the month end process by collating and processing data 
  • Support in the reconciliation of monthly balance sheets
  • Assist in the review of nominal ledgers and make accruals and prepayments
  • Support and assist the Treasury Team to enable them to fulfil their core responsibilities
  • Work with the Management Accounts Manager and Treasury Team Leader to help ensure high levels of compliance and financial control
  • Assist with the development and implementation of new and improved processes and procedures
Skills required for the role:
  • Strong IT skills, that include Excel
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Organised and an effective team player
